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.
| Model | Per session | Once invoked |
|---|---|---|
| Fable 5.1 | $0.00122 | $0.01372 |
| Opus 5 | $0.00061 | $0.00686 |
| Sonnet 5 | $0.00024 | $0.00274 |
| Haiku 4.5 | $0.00012 | $0.00137 |
Grade A, and why
ai-ad-video sc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ured 12d ago.
A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.
Nothing flagged
None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.

AI Ad Video
Overview
AI Ad Video helps creators, video editors, advertisers, e-commerce teams, social-commerce teams, and short-form story producers produce advertising concepts, paid-social clips, and brand commercials with AI Hive. Describe the intended subject, action, camera, lighting, pacing, and constraints; the bundled CLI handles AI Hive OpenAPI calls and downloads the finished video.
Why use this skill
- Brief to result: work from plain-English creative direction instead of writing API requests
- Controlled inputs: use the exact first frame, last frame, image, video, or audio references required by this capability
- Predictable model selection: the skill name matches the public model ID used by the script
- Live pricing: fetch the active model configuration and pricing snapshot before submission
- Production-friendly delivery: preserve the task ID, poll one task safely, and download results automatically
Best for
Ads, tvcs, product videos, e-commerce listings, social commerce, ugc-style seeding content, short dramas, motion comics, and storyboards. It is also useful when users search for AI advertising, paid social, ad video, commercial video.

ai-ad-video is a skill published in the GitHub repository wubin1836/ai-hive-agent-skills (8 stars, last pushed 2d ago), licensed MIT. It adds 122 tokens to every session and 1,372 once invoked, about $0.0006 per session on Opus 5. A static security scan graded it A with 0 findings. No closer match exists in the catalogue, so it is treated as the original; first seen 2026-08-31.
